Key features of high-quality kitchen twine
When selecting twine for packaging, businesses must ensure the product meets commercial requirements. High-quality twine is designed to handle handling stress while maintaining a clean appearance:
- Strong knot retention that holds through handling and transport
- Food-safe natural fibres suitable for contact with packaged goods
- Consistent thickness for a uniform look across batches
- Minimal lint and shedding for clean presentation

Common uses in food packaging
Many food-related industries rely on kitchen twine as part of their standard packaging process. Its flexibility allows it to secure various food products while enhancing presentation:
- Wrapping bakery boxes and pastry packaging
- Tying bread bags and artisan loaves
- Securing gift baskets and gourmet bundles
- Closing paper packaging and kraft wraps
- Attaching labels and branding tags

Advantages of natural twine in food packaging
One reason many companies adopt natural kitchen twine is its compatibility with environmentally responsible packaging strategies. Natural twine supports sustainable branding and reduces reliance on plastic packaging elements:
- Biodegradable and compostable at end of life
- Plastic-free presentation aligned with eco-trends
- A clean, artisanal appearance that strengthens brand perception
- Compatible with kraft paper, bakery boxes and parchment wrapping
These materials balance strength and flexibility: staff tie packages quickly while contents remain intact during handling, storage and transport.
Choosing the right kitchen twine for packaging operations
Food businesses sourcing packaging twine should evaluate several factors to ensure reliable performance – twine quality directly influences durability and ease of use in daily operations.
Important considerations include fibre material, spool size, knot strength and consistency of manufacturing. Businesses that rely heavily on packaging processes often prefer twine supplied in bulk spools to streamline workflows and reduce costs.
